Andy Frantz - Program Director
Andy brings his enthusiasm for education and public service to the program. Andy has 10 years of experience as an English teacher in the public schools of Nogales, Arizona and Belchertown, Massachusetts. He has also taught composition at Lorain County Community College. "Teaching is an act of faith," says Andy. "You put your best self into each interaction with every student. You may never know if you are reaching someone, changing their life by what you teach them or how you treat them--but you keep doing it, believing that you are making a difference."
